what it is

A scrapbook app for train travel: a place to log a journey — the route, the stops, the views out the window — and keep the whole trip in one place instead of scattered across a camera roll.

the problem

A good train trip is made of small things — the landscape sliding by, a meal in the dining car, a town you'll never otherwise see. They're worth keeping, but they scatter: a few photos here, a half-remembered stop there, and the shape of the trip is gone by the time you're home.

how it works

Start a journey, trace the route, and add the moments as you go — a photo, a note, the name of a station. When you're back, you have a keepsake of the whole trip rather than a pile of loose pictures. Named for the observation car: the glass-walled lounge where the best of a train ride tends to happen.
